A Conjoint Project enables you
to measure the tradeoff of each potential element (attribute) within a
product, service, message, etc. By assigning a specific value to each
individual element, you can then design the optimal product for the
target audience, and focus on the most important features in the
marketing message. For example, the goal may be to statistically figure
out which products or services will be successful before the product is
introduced to the market.
